Keutanaguan is a Rural village located in Panikoili, Jajapur, Odisha.
The total population of Keutanaguan is 723.
Keutanaguan village comprises 161 households.
The literacy rate in Keutanaguan is 82.9%. Among the literate population of 540, there are 308 literate males and 232 literate females.
In Keutanaguan, there are 373 males and 350 females, with a sex ratio of 938 females per 1000 males.
There are 72 children (10% of population), comprising 36 boys and 36 girls.
The total number of workers in Keutanaguan is 210, with 204 main workers and 6 marginal workers.
In Keutanaguan, there are 358 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(182 males, 176 females) and 10 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(4 males, 6 females).
Keutanaguan is located in Odisha state, Jajapur district, and falls under Panikoili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 400868 and LGD code is 400868.
